The global gaming laptop market presents a paradoxical landscape in 2026. While overall trade volume in the broader laptop category has contracted by 12.85% year-over-year, gaming laptops have emerged as a bright spot with 28.7% demand growth and 31.2% supply expansion. This divergence signals a fundamental shift in consumer preferences toward high-performance computing for gaming, content creation, and AI applications. For Southeast Asian manufacturers, this represents a critical window of opportunity to pivot from commoditized laptop production to specialized gaming segments.
Global Gaming Laptop Market Dynamics (2025-2026)
| Metric | 2025 | 2026 (Projected) |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Global Market Size | $18.2B | $22.4B | +23.1% |
| CAGR (2024-2030) | 14.2% | 16.8% | +2.6pp |
| Average Selling Price | $1,240 | $1,380 | +11.3% |
| Premium Segment (> $1,500) | 32% | 38% | +6pp |
Geographic analysis reveals that the United States (32.1%), Germany (18.7%), and the United Kingdom (12.4%) dominate demand, accounting for over 63% of global purchases. These markets share common characteristics: high disposable income, established gaming cultures, and sophisticated consumer expectations regarding build quality and technical support. Southeast Asian exporters must prioritize these markets while developing products that meet their specific requirements.
